Had total on December 6 with bladder tear

Hi all
I'm a day out of having my total hysterctomy. My surgery last 4+ hours due to the complication of having my bladder torn. Nurses say I look great and could be discharged but bc of the bladder issue I can't. I must wear a catheter for two weeks and can't even take a day. I feel the tube and it's driving me insane. My surgery incisions are healing and some black and blue but pain is coming from feeling these things inside me. It's taking over my thoughts. I was never one who could wear tampons and this feels like several are stuck. I'm at my wits end. Anyone else go through a total hysterctomy and have a bladder tear? I'm praying doc will take out catheter.

Re: Had total on December 6 with bladder tear

Good Morning Ponylvr:

I had a bladder tear also and had to wear the Foley catheter for a week. They gave me a medication that turned my urine BRIGHT orange but it decreased the discomfort. My dr explained to me that they have to keep the catheter in because the bladder cannot expand while it is healing. The catheter was my "psychological" undoing while it was in but I am glad that I had it and my bladder healed. Here's the positive: it forced me to take it easy because I could not do anything w the "bag"...

Re: Had total on December 6 with bladder tear

The dr put a hole in my bladder when cleaning scar tissue during my LAVH and I had to come home with catheter for 2 wks it was a bummer, but it was a blessing as well because it kept me from doing too much too soon. I did not leave my house during that time but I walked by doing laps within my home . I have to say that I healed well during that time and I called it my " pee bag purse " I felt amazing the day the dr took the catheter out!!!! Hang in there and try to enjoy your down time it does get better , happy healing !
